8.0Reserva Amazonica is a beautiful property located 40mins by bost from Puerto Maldonado. We spent 2 nights there and generally had a good experience. The lodges are beautiful, clean and well equipped and staff is really nice and attentive. The nature surrounding the hotel is beautiful and there are some small animals / birds that can be found on property. The included excursions are interesting (we mostly enjoyed the canopy walk and lake Sandoval). Unfortunately, we were there during a cold spell and we only had limited animal sightings. A few points for improvement: 1) We didn't have hot water at any point during our stay. Probably ok when it's super hot outside, but not good when the weather is cold 2) Our flight was slightly delayed and we arrived at 15:30 the first day. Lunch was extended to accommodate us, which was great, but there was no communication/ discussion about the details of the excursions, which we only found out during the night boat ride. Would have been good to be able to choose what excursions we wanted, or at least have the schedule upfront so we know what we're doing 3) The SPA is not equipped for cold weather (it's an open building like the lodges) and the massage was not enjoyable due to the room being too cold.

Children under 18 are generally not allowed to stay at properties in Peru without a parent, legal guardian or duly authorized responsible person. Accompanying adults may be asked for both their and the child's ID as well as any duly notarized supporting documentation. Visitors who plan to travel with children should consult with a Peruvian consulate office prior to travel for further guidance.
According to Peruvian law, cash is not accepted for payments over PEN 2,000 or USD 500. Payments greater than these amounts must be settled by credit card or other methods approved by the property and local law. Payments cannot be split between currencies.
